#1e5598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1e5598 is composed of 11.8% red, 33.3%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.3% cyan, 44.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 213 degrees, a saturation of 67% and a lightness of 35.7%. #1e5598 color hex could be obtained by blending #3caaff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#1e5598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010305 is the darkest color, while #f3f7f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e5598
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#565b60 is the less saturated color, while #0252b4 is the most saturated one.
